(Bukan) Cerita Si Kerudung Merah
Indonesia/ 2022/ 7 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Ayara Bhanukusuma
Titien, a trans woman who lives with her foster child, Ayu. Titien looks for her missing veil while Ayu is worried about the stigma and bullying against her and her mother, especially since her mother is a trans woman who wears a headscarf.
Accolades
- Official Selection, 100% Manusia Film Festival 2022

Closeting (Dan Bahagia)
Indonesia/ 2022/ 20 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Kurnia Alexander
Ahmad a closeted gay Muslin man finds out that his boyfriend has just passed away as he is about to celebrate his 25th birthday with his mother and close friends at home. Ahmad tries to deal with it alone, but he is unable to do so as he has to keep pretending that everything is okay in front of them. As the day goes by, Ahmad finds it harder to keep everything bottled up inside.
Accolades
- Official Selection, Jakarta Film Week 2022
- Official Selection, Jogja NETPAC Asian Film Festival 2022

Makassar is A City of Football Fans
(Lika Liku Laki)
Indonesia/ 2021/ 20 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Khozy Rizal
In a city where men have to go crazy about football, Akbar has to pretend to love the game in order to prevent rejection from his new college friends.
Accolades
- Best Short Film nominee, Sundance Film Festival 2022
- Best Short Film nominee, Festival Film Indonesia 2021
- Light of Asia Short Film nominee, Jogja-NETPAC Asian Film Festival 2021

The Sea Calls For Me
(Laut Memanggilku)
Indonesia/ 2021/ 18 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Tumpal Tampubolon
A young boy lives alone in a fishing village. He earns money by doing chores while waiting for his father who may never return. One day he finds a broken sex doll washed ashore and tries to fix it.
Accolades
- Best Screenplay, Best Photography, and Audience Awards, Desenzano Film Festival 2022
- Best Short Film, Festival Film Indonesia 2021
- Best Asian Short Film, Busan International Film Festival 2021

Ride to Nowhere
Indonesia/ 2021/ 15 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Khozy Rizal
Ade, a 35 years old woman, has lost her job and has to pay for her apartment soon. When she started working as an online motorbike driver, she encountered a problem. Most of the passengers cancel their orders because Ade is a woman. Upon witnessing this, Ade brews her plan.
Accolades
- Official Selection, Minikino Film Week 2022
- Short Film Competition finalist, Sundance Film Festival: Asia 2022

Uniform ( Seragam)
Indonesia/ 2020/ 12 Mins/ Drama
Indonesian with English subtitles
Director: Brahmma Putra Wijaya
Set in the 1998 monetary crisis, this short film examines the theme of masculinity and its impact on 3 generations: Grandparents, parents and children. Triggered by a fight between two boys over a broken toy. It becomes a complicated argument among parents involving class, power, gender differences and the problems that arise from ancient idealism.
Accolades
- Official Selection, Jogja-NETPAC Asian Film Festival 2020
- Official Selection, BLOW-UP Chicago International Arthouse Film Festival 2020
